簡體   English   中英

為異步C#.net編寫回調函數

[英]Writing a callback function for async c#.net

我正在使用Kinvey進行存儲

非異步 函數的回調如下所示

myClient.User().create(myUserName, myPassword, new KinveyUserCallback(){...});

如果我正在使用異步 功能,該怎么辦?

myClient.User().createAsync(myUserName, myPassword);

我對onError回調感興趣,以檢查用戶是否已經存在。

在kinvey的文檔中,他們明確指出:

如果用戶名確實存在,則將調用回調的onError方法

因此,當您執行以下代碼時:

User user = await myClient.User().createAsync(myUserName, myPassword);

如果用戶已經存在 ,您將在onError函數中收到如下錯誤消息。

@Override
public void onError(String error) {
     // do something with the error
     // maybe log it and/or throw the error to UI
}

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M